Проблема в фазе анализа для строительства портала Shcool

StackOverflow https://stackoverflow.com/questions/2447874

  •  20-09-2019
  •  | 
  •  

Вопрос

Я строю школьный портал, и я застрял на этапе анализа, проблема:

На школьном портале есть профиль учащегося и родительский профиль, теперь проблема заключается в том, как я могу достичь взаимосвязи между этими двумя. На самом деле сценарий: «Один папа может иметь несколько детей, обучающихся в разных школах», теперь предположим, что «папа хочет посмотреть В результате/замечаниях его всех детей «на чем он может достичь, это мой вопрос.

Это было полезно?

Решение

У ребенка принадлежат родителю, а родители, родитель, у детей, у детей есть дети

Чтобы получить результаты, ему придется назначить детей. Он может претендовать на «право собственности» ребенка. Администратор в школе должен нести ответственность за подтверждение или отрицание этого, в противном случае у вас серьезные головные боли.

Другие советы

У ребенка должно быть представительство для того, кем является их отец.

Затем забрать на основе этого.

Parent --------------
            |       |
            |       |
          CHILD   CHILD has Parentid (foreign key) AND schoolid so u can bind child to parent and school
            |       |
            |       |
           EXAM    EXAM has id of Child (foreign key) so u can bind exam on child/student
            |       | 
            |       |  
          RESULTS RESULTS has id of Exam (foreign key) so u can bind results to exam1...*

Попробуйте решить это так. У каждого родителя может быть несколько детей. Чайлдс может сдать экзамены, экзамены имеют результаты. Теперь вы можете принять данные, спросив детей родителей.

Выберите C.name из ребенка C, родитель P, где C.parentid = 1

Вы бы знали идентификатор родителя, так что тогда вы можете просто запросить ребенка на этом удостоверении личности. Как эта детская запись узнает, кто родитель.

Когда вы хотите добавить возможность поставить ребенка в школу, и у родителей может быть 1 ...* Childs в разных школах:

Таблица: у ребенка есть школьница (FK).

  • Родитель регистрируется в вашей системе. Родитель сейчас имеет удостоверение личности.
  • Родитель может зарегистрировать несколько детей с разными идентификаторами.
  • Дети могут быть зарегистрированы для школы.
  • Дети могут сдать разные экзамены с результатами.
Лицензировано под: CC-BY-SA с атрибуция
Не связан с StackOverflow
scroll top